MAHARAJAH OF GWALIOR.
(Received June 7th, 5.5 p.m.) *""■ PARIS, June .1 , The denth of the Maharajah jf Gwalior took place at St. Cloud today' [His Highness the Maharajah Sindkk of Gwalior, G.C.V.0., G.C.SJ,w»wS on October 20th in 1876 and succeed*} to the throne in ISS6. He was an heaorary and extra A.D.C. to the KW and an honorary Colonel of the Ist Data of York's Own Lancers. He west'to China as an orderly officer to General Gaselee in 1901, and provided the en*. dition with a hospital ship. He orgm. ised the hospital ship Loyalty in Ifti and financed it for the duration of the war. His troops fought with distinction in France, East Africa, Egypt, ,ta& Mesopotamia. Ho was granted a SS&te of 21 guns at the 1911 Durbar, wnjeh was made hereditary in 1917. He Via an lion. D.C.L. of Oxford and an hfflu LL.D. of Cambridge, and the holderof several decorations. The King stoai sponsor to his heir, who was bora? is. 191 C]
